The QNAP QXG-10G2T-X710 is a dual-port 10GbE network expansion card designed to boost network speed and connectivity for demanding environments. Featuring an Intel Ethernet Controller X710 and a PCIe 3.0 x4 interface, it supports multiple speeds including 10G, 5G, 2.5G, 1G, and 100M. This flexibility allows it to adapt to various network setups, making it a strong choice for users needing faster data transfer and improved network performance.
Its ability to combine both ports through Port Trunking enables transfer speeds up to 20Gbps, which is particularly useful for large file sharing, virtualization, and expanding network storage. The card is compatible with QNAP NAS devices as well as Windows and Linux systems, offering broad usability across different platforms.
This expansion card offers dual RJ45 ports that support a wide range of network speeds, making it adaptable to existing infrastructure without requiring new cabling. Its PCIe 3.0 x4 interface ensures that data flows quickly between the card and the host system, minimizing bottlenecks. The card’s compatibility with QNAP NAS devices as well as Windows and Linux operating systems means it can be integrated into diverse environments, from home servers to professional IT setups.
Equipped with the Intel Ethernet Controller X710, the card delivers consistent and reliable network performance even under heavy workloads. Features like SR-IOV support improve virtual machine efficiency by allowing better resource allocation, which is essential for virtualization and cloud computing tasks. The inclusion of iSCSI support further enhances storage network performance, making it easier to expand and manage network-attached storage.
The QXG-10G2T-X710 comes with multiple bracket options, including low-profile, full-height, and specialized brackets, ensuring it fits a variety of computer cases and rackmount servers. This flexibility simplifies installation in different hardware environments. The card’s plug-and-play design with broad OS support reduces setup time, allowing users to quickly upgrade their network capabilities without complex configuration.
